MoreAug 27, 2019· The minerals calcite and dolomite are chemically similar and actually form a series ranging from pure calcium carbonate calcite to pure calcium, magnesium, carbonate dolomite. The magnesium atoms that substitute for the calcium are a bit smaller than those of calcium, and this affects the appearance of many dolomite crystals.
MoreCalcite and dolomite are very similar minerals. Both have the same hardness (H = 3), the same rhombohedral cleavage, and are found in identical geologic settings. The best way to tell one from the other is the acid test: a drop of 1 M HCl on calcite produces an instant, obvious fizz; a drop on dolomite produces slow or no obvious bubbling.

MoreIf calcite dissolves much more rapidly than dolomite, calcite saturation would be attained much before dolomite saturation. After calcite saturation is reached, dolomite would continue to dissolve, but incongruently, until dolomite saturation is reached. The Ca 2 +/Mg 2 + molal ratio would evolve from a high initial value to a much lower value

MoreMn 2+ appears to be the most abundant and important activator in natural calcite and dolomite. Substituting for calcium in both minerals, its emission is orange-red to orange-yellow, with a fairly broad band between 570-640 nm (maximum between 590-620 nm). MoreDolomite differs from calcite, CaCO3, in the addition of magnesium ions to make the formula, CaMg(CO3)2. The magnesium ions are not the same size as calcium and the two ions seem incompatible in the same layer. MoreDolomite: Dolomite is the name of a sedimentary carbonate rock and a mineral,both composed of calcium magnesium carbonate camg (CO3)2 found in crystals.Limestone that is partially replaced by dolomite is referred to as dolomitic limestone. Calcite: Calcite is a carbonate mineral and the most stable polymorph of calcium carbonate (CaCO3).
